Abstract

In the United States, the requirements addressing the safety and performance of medical equipment are published by the FDA or the Nuclear Regulatory Commission or are promulgated by the states through their health departments. In many cases, specific requirements for safety and performance originate from standards published by the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C). The design of equipment for radiology and radiation therapy is likewise affected a great deal by IEC standards.
